Antti Kervinen 700c944c4d libct: fix resetting CPU affinity
unix.CPUSet is limited to 1024 CPUs. Calling
unix.SchedSetaffinity(pid, cpuset) removes all CPUs starting from 1024
from allowed CPUs of pid, even if cpuset is all ones. As a
consequence, when runc tries to reset CPU affinity to "allow all" by
default, it prevents all containers from CPUs 1024 onwards.

This change uses a huge CPU mask to play safe and get all possible
CPUs enabled with a single sched_setaffinity call.

package linux
import (
"os"
"unsafe"
"golang.org/x/sys/unix"
)
// Dup3 wraps [unix.Dup3].
func Dup3(oldfd, newfd, flags int) error {
err := retryOnEINTR(func() error {
return unix.Dup3(oldfd, newfd, flags)
})
return os.NewSyscallError("dup3", err)
}
// Exec wraps [unix.Exec].
func Exec(cmd string, args, env []string) error {
err := retryOnEINTR(func() error {
return unix.Exec(cmd, args, env)
})
if err != nil {
return &os.PathError{Op: "exec", Path: cmd, Err: err}
}
return nil
}
// Getwd wraps [unix.Getwd].
func Getwd() (wd string, err error) {
wd, err = retryOnEINTR2(unix.Getwd)
return wd, os.NewSyscallError("getwd", err)
}
// Open wraps [unix.Open].
func Open(path string, mode int, perm uint32) (fd int, err error) {
fd, err = retryOnEINTR2(func() (int, error) {
return unix.Open(path, mode, perm)
})
if err != nil {
return -1, &os.PathError{Op: "open", Path: path, Err: err}
}
return fd, nil
}
// Openat wraps [unix.Openat].
func Openat(dirfd int, path string, mode int, perm uint32) (fd int, err error) {
fd, err = retryOnEINTR2(func() (int, error) {
return unix.Openat(dirfd, path, mode, perm)
})
if err != nil {
return -1, &os.PathError{Op: "openat", Path: path, Err: err}
}
return fd, nil
}
// Recvfrom wraps [unix.Recvfrom].
func Recvfrom(fd int, p []byte, flags int) (n int, from unix.Sockaddr, err error) {
err = retryOnEINTR(func() error {
n, from, err = unix.Recvfrom(fd, p, flags)
return err
})
if err != nil {
return 0, nil, os.NewSyscallError("recvfrom", err)
}
return n, from, err
}
// SchedSetaffinity wraps sched_setaffinity syscall without unix.CPUSet size limitation.
func SchedSetaffinity(pid int, buf []byte) error {
err := retryOnEINTR(func() error {
_, _, errno := unix.Syscall(
unix.SYS_SCHED_SETAFFINITY,
uintptr(pid),
uintptr(len(buf)),
uintptr((unsafe.Pointer)(&buf[0])))
if errno != 0 {
return errno
}
return nil
})
return os.NewSyscallError("sched_setaffinity", err)
}
// Sendmsg wraps [unix.Sendmsg].
func Sendmsg(fd int, p, oob []byte, to unix.Sockaddr, flags int) error {
err := retryOnEINTR(func() error {
return unix.Sendmsg(fd, p, oob, to, flags)
})
return os.NewSyscallError("sendmsg", err)
}
// SetMempolicy wraps set_mempolicy.
func SetMempolicy(mode int, mask *unix.CPUSet) error {
err := retryOnEINTR(func() error {
return unix.SetMemPolicy(mode, mask)
})
return os.NewSyscallError("set_mempolicy", err)
}
// Readlinkat wraps [unix.Readlinkat].
func Readlinkat(dir *os.File, path string) (string, error) {
size := 4096
for {
linkBuf := make([]byte, size)
n, err := retryOnEINTR2(func() (int, error) {
return unix.Readlinkat(int(dir.Fd()), path, linkBuf)
})
if err != nil {
return "", &os.PathError{Op: "readlinkat", Path: dir.Name() + "/" + path, Err: err}
}
if n != size {
return string(linkBuf[:n]), nil
}
// Possible truncation, resize the buffer.
size *= 2
}
}
// GetPtyPeer is a wrapper for ioctl(TIOCGPTPEER).
func GetPtyPeer(ptyFd uintptr, unsafePeerPath string, flags int) (*os.File, error) {
// Make sure O_NOCTTY is always set -- otherwise runc might accidentally
// gain it as a controlling terminal. O_CLOEXEC also needs to be set to
// make sure we don't leak the handle either.
flags |= unix.O_NOCTTY | unix.O_CLOEXEC
// There is no nice wrapper for this kind of ioctl in unix.
peerFd, _, errno := unix.Syscall(
unix.SYS_IOCTL,
ptyFd,
uintptr(unix.TIOCGPTPEER),
uintptr(flags),
)
if errno != 0 {
return nil, os.NewSyscallError("ioctl TIOCGPTPEER", errno)
}
return os.NewFile(peerFd, unsafePeerPath), nil
}
